✨ The Cervantino Festival arrives in San Miguel de Allende! As part of Mexico’s most important cultural festival, Casa Europa México is proud to present this unique concert.

đź“– Event Synopsis
Kora Flamenca is a unique encounter between the Mandinka music of virtuoso kora player Zal Sissokho and the flamenco of acclaimed guitarist and composer Caroline Planté, joined by Mexican percussionist Miguel Medina.

Their artistic proposal creates an immersive sound journey that celebrates diversity and unity through art, intertwining influences from West Africa and Spanish flamenco. Each piece tells a story that connects ancestral traditions with contemporary sensibilities, resonating deeply with Latin American and North American audiences alike.

👥 Artists

  • Zal Sissokho – Originally from Senegal, based in Canada and Mexico. An internationally recognized virtuoso of the kora (a 21-string African harp), acclaimed for blending Mandinka tradition with contemporary genres.
  • Caroline PlantĂ© – Canadian guitarist and composer with deep training in flamenco. She has collaborated on international projects that cross musical and cultural boundaries.
  • Miguel Medina – Mexican percussionist whose rhythmic versatility bridges both traditions and enriches the musical dialogue.

With their debut album La Source and new stage projects, Kora Flamenca represents a true cultural bridge between Africa, Europe, and the Americas.
